Large Portrait of a Clergyman-Painter. Early 20th Century. Artist:Inscribed on the back: Ernest Faut
A remarkable large portrait of a clergyman-painter
from the early 20th century.
It is a large oil on canvas measuring, without the frame,
115 cm x 75.5 cm. It is presented in a
gilded and patinated wooden frame measuring 122 cm x 82.5 cm.
The canvas bears no signature but has numerous markings on the back
on the stretcher indicating, in Dutch, the name of a clergyman and the name
of the painter, Ernest Faut.
Ernest Faut was a Flemish-Belgian painter born in 1879 and died in 1961.
He was a draftsman, painter, and lithographer
of decorative works, interiors, psychological portraits,
religious scenes, churches, and beguinages.
Ernest Faut began his studies at the Brussels Academy under
Constant Montald and also studied at the Leuven Academy under
Constantin Meunier. He taught for forty years at the Academy of Leuven
, where he eventually became director.
Faut produced technically masterful paintings, featuring a delicate and sensitive
color palette. Faut also employed the chiaroscuro technique.
In the 1930s, his work consisted mainly of
symbolic scenes with a late-period influence of Art Nouveau.
Some paintings are characterized by a misty melancholy.
Faut’s work is scattered among several museums, including the Leuven Museum.
